Just last seasgn Bristol City finished 17th of the 22 teams in the first division. This was after barely avoiding relegation the year - previous. This season City finished 9th, well established in the top half of the first division. Bristol city has been in the Football Association’ since 1894 and have fielded a professional side since 1897. Throughout their long history the club has bounced through three divisions. Bristol City boasts a multi- national International side with Terry Cooper, Norman Hunter and Joe -Royle holding full caps for England with Chris Garland as an under 23 English In- ternational. Cooper and Hunter are defenders while Garland and Royle are strikers. Peter Cormack isa full International for Scotland while Gerry Gow and Don Gillies both hold under 23 honors for the Scottish side. . A definite Scottish flavor comes out on the club. Striker - Tom” Ritchie, Midfielder Gerry Sweeney and Goalkeeper John Shaw all come from the far side of Hadrian’s Wall. Soccer jamboree heralded as success North and West Vancouver boys participated in the first ever Dairyland Sportmanship Soccer Jamboree held recently at Strathcona Park in Vancouver. A total of over 250 participants from all over the lower mainland took part in the two day event in which teams were formed randomly and no team had more than three or four players from one club. The jamboree was design- ed for boys playing -on Division 5 under 13 year old community recreation teams. The event was billed as concentrating on the values of sportsmanship, fellowship and participation rather than as ai highly competitive tournament. Participants to the jam- boree had been selected beforehand on the basis of their sportsmanship qualities on and off the field. The chairman of the B.C. Youth Soccer Association, Ken Lind commented that ‘the event was truly a great experience for all the young participants.”’ The B.C. Youth Soccer Association co-hosted and fully sanctioned the event.
